				 Flaming arrows. Bug or WAD? 
 So, in a current MP game as Patala I've noticed that when casting flaming arrows, not all missile weapons are getting the fire bonus. Meaning that Bandar and Atavi archers get the bonus while Markata archers and light Bandar warriors (the one with sticks and stones) do net get the bonus.
 Any advice on that?

				 Re: Flaming arrows. Bug or WAD? 
 Both. From the mechanics point of view it's WAD. All weapons that get flaming versions actually have a counterpart named "Fire ", so long bow becomes fire long bow, which is a normal long bow with a secondary effect of fire (8 AP or 6 AP, don't remember). Currently small bow and sticks & stones do not have fire versions.
 It's a bug in he sense that those missile weapons should have fire versions. I should add that to the shortlist when I fix the formatting.
